• rth's avatar
    PR middle-end/17799 · 553acd9c
    rth authored
            * function.c (use_register_for_decl): Check DECL_IGNORED_P instead
            of DECL_ARTIFICIAL.
            (assign_parms_augmented_arg_list): Set DECL_IGNORED_P.
            * c-decl.c (build_compound_literal): Likewise.
            * dwarf2asm.c (dw2_force_const_mem): Likewise.
            * gimplify.c (create_artificial_label): Likewise.
            * tree-inline.c (expand_call_inline): Likewise.
            * var-tracking.c (vt_initialize): Likewise.
            * tree-outof-ssa.c (create_temp): Copy DECL_IGNORED_P.
    cp/
            * call.c (make_temporary_var_for_ref_to_temp): Set DECL_IGNORED_P.
            * class.c (build_vtable): Don't conditionallize setting it
            based on DWARF2_DEBUG.
            (layout_class_type): Set DECL_IGNORED_P.
            * decl2.c (get_guard): Likewise.
            * rtti.c (get_tinfo_decl, build_lang_decl): Likewise.
            * tree.c (build_local_temp): Likewise.
    
    
    git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@92781 138bc75d-0d04-0410-961f-82ee72b054a4
    553acd9c
class.c 237 KB